Output e561cc691f5840b83090304e62eea13a8408adeffeea9897720395303956833e:32

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 ccf74bf5c72dc17c5638c7f3366885771b91a486
address
bc1qenm5haw89hqhc43cclenv6y9wuderfyxhgdnf7
transaction
e561cc691f5840b83090304e62eea13a8408adeffeea9897720395303956833e